Background
Endoscopic Submucosal Dissection (ESD) is a new treatment means appearing in recent years, is a technology with good clinical application prospect, enables more early digestive tract cancers to be completely resected under an endoscope at one time, and avoids the pain of an open surgery and the resection of organs. Compared with the endoscope treatment methods such as laparotomy and EMR, the ESD has the following advantages: 1) the wound is small; 2) the patient may receive multiple treatments at multiple sites; 3) allowing the physician to obtain a complete histopathological specimen for analysis; 4) the resection rate of the tumor with large area and irregular shape or combined ulcer and scar is more than 96 percent to reduce the recurrence probability. With the continuous development of modern digestive endoscopy diagnosis and treatment technologies, particularly the wide development of therapeutic endoscopes, the wide development of EMR \ ESD operation, the development of ESE \ EFR and the like derived from the EMR \ ESD operation, large-area mucosal defects or local gastrointestinal wall perforation continuously occur. The ability to suture the wound surface in time is often the most critical factor in preventing the development of more serious complications such as late bleeding and abdominal infection. The continuous development of new auxiliary suturing devices is one of the current research directions.

The specific embodiment of the utility model is shown in fig. 1, a hemostatic clamp under endoscope with barbed line, which comprises a plurality of hemostatic clamp bodies 1, a releaser 2 and a barbed line 3 connected with one hemostatic clamp body 1 of the hemostatic clamp bodies 1, wherein the hemostatic clamp body 1 is provided with 2 clamping arms which can be opened and closed; the releaser 2 is used for being detachably connected with the hemostatic clamp body 1 and releasing the hemostatic clamp body 1 to a human body; barb line 3 includes line body 301 and the barb 302 that the length direction interval of line body 301 set up, wherein one end and the line body 301 of barb 302 are connected, and the other end of barb 302 inclines to and forms acute angle contained angle between the line body 301 to same direction, barb line 3 be close to the other end of barb 302 one end with one of them hemostatic clamp body 1 2 one of the arm lock is connected, the one end that barb line 3 deviates from the other end of barb 302 is connected with magnetic bead 4, still includes the magnet that is used for attracting magnetic bead 4.
2 one side that the arm lock is relative be equipped with the concave-convex tooth 101 of interlock when closed, the connected mode of barb line 3 and arm lock can be: barb line 3 is binded on the arm lock, perhaps barb line 3 bonds on the arm lock, perhaps barb line 3 hot pressing is in on the arm lock, this embodiment is the bonding.
The working method of the hemostatic clamp with the barbed wire 3 in the embodiment is shown in fig. 2 to 4, the hemostatic clamp body 1 with the barbed wire 3 enters the tissue to be sutured and hemostatic through the digestive endoscope channel under the action of the releaser 2, and the first part of the tissue is clamped and fixed, the remaining hemostatic clamp bodies 1 enter the digestive endoscope channel sequentially under the action of the releaser 2, after each remaining hemostatic clamp body 1 enters the human body, the magnetic bead 4 is attracted from the outside of the body through the magnet to adjust the position of the barbed wire 3 according to the suturing requirement under the monitoring of the endoscope, the other side is opened, the middle of the two clamp arms of the hemostatic clamp body 1 is ensured to pass through the barbed wire 3, the appropriate part is selected to clamp and close, the barbed wire 3 is pulled to be close to the hemostatic clamp bodies 1 as much as possible, the barb 302 of the barbed wire 3 clamps the remaining hemostatic clamp bodies 1 and fixes the remaining hemostatic clamp bodies 1, so send into the human body in proper order remaining hemostatic clamp body 1 and fix in waiting to sew up hemostatic tissue department to the realization is with taking the hemostatic clamp body 1 of barb line 3 and remaining hemostatic clamp body 1 combination to carry out effectively jointly and rapidly sew up, thereby accomplishes the hemostatic purpose.
The hemostatic clamp body 1 and the releaser 2 may be selected from all hemostatic clamp structure types, opening widths, angles, releasers 2 adapted to the hemostatic clamp body 1 in the prior art, such as the hemostatic clamp and the releaser 2 in chinese patent document (application No. 201310524901.6), the clip applier capable of continuously releasing the hemostatic clamp in chinese patent document (application No. 201420787281.5), and the hemostatic clamp without a pull wire as disclosed in chinese patent document (201720070256.9). The barbed wire 3 may be made of any surgical barbed wire 3 known in the art.
